How to Install and Uninstall dovecot-ldap Package on Kali Linux

Last updated: April 29,2024

1. Install "dovecot-ldap" package

This tutorial shows how to install dovecot-ldap on Kali Linux

$ sudo apt update $ sudo apt install dovecot-ldap

2. Uninstall "dovecot-ldap" package

This guide let you learn how to uninstall dovecot-ldap on Kali Linux:

$ sudo apt remove dovecot-ldap $ sudo apt autoclean && sudo apt autoremove

Description: secure POP3/IMAP server - LDAP support
Dovecot is a mail server whose major goals are security and extreme
reliability. It tries very hard to handle all error conditions and verify
that all data is valid, making it nearly impossible to crash. It supports
mbox/Maildir and its own dbox/mdbox formats, and should also be pretty
fast, extensible, and portable.
.
This package provides LDAP support for Dovecot.
